  **Introduction**

  Cable glands are used to protect and secure cables in industrial environments, preventing damage and ensuring a stable connection. The M12 cable gland is a popular choice due to its compact size, robust design, and versatility. Made from stainless steel, these glands offer excellent durability and resistance to corrosion, making them ideal for harsh industrial conditions.

  **What is a Stainless Steel M12 Cable Gland?**

  A stainless steel M12 cable gland is a type of cable gland designed for use with M12 connectors. It is made from stainless steel, a material known for its strength, corrosion resistance, and durability. The M12 cable gland is characterized by its compact size, making it suitable for applications with limited space.

  **Applications of Stainless Steel M12 Cable Glands**

  Stainless steel M12 cable glands are widely used in various industrial applications, including:

  1. **Automotive Industry**: They are used in vehicles for securing and protecting cables in engine compartments, undercarriages, and other areas exposed to harsh conditions.
2. **Manufacturing**: These glands are used in manufacturing plants for securing cables in machinery, robots, and other equipment.
3. **Construction**: They are used in construction projects for securing cables in buildings, bridges, and other structures.
4. **Energy Sector**: Stainless steel M12 cable glands are used in renewable energy systems, such as wind turbines and solar panels, to protect cables in outdoor environments.

  **Benefits of Using Stainless Steel M12 Cable Glands**

  There are several benefits to using stainless steel M12 cable glands:

  1. **Corrosion Resistance**: Stainless steel is highly resistant to corrosion, making these glands ideal for use in harsh industrial environments.
2. **Durability**: The robust design of stainless steel M12 cable glands ensures they can withstand harsh conditions, such as high temperatures, moisture, and vibration.
3. **Versatility**: These glands are available in various sizes and configurations, making them suitable for a wide range of applications.
4. **Easy Installation**: Stainless steel M12 cable glands are easy to install, saving time and effort in the field.

  **How to Choose the Right Stainless Steel M12 Cable Gland**

  When selecting a stainless steel M12 cable gland, consider the following factors:

  1. **Cable Size**: Ensure the gland is compatible with the size of your cable.
2. **Environmental Conditions**: Choose a gland that is suitable for the conditions in which it will be used, such as temperature, humidity, and vibration.
3. **Connection Type**: Select a gland that matches the type of connector you are using.
4. **Material**: Ensure the gland is made from stainless steel to provide the necessary corrosion resistance and durability.
